Female Western bluebirds have a blue-gray chin and neck, while female Eastern bluebirds have an orange or cream chin and neck 4. Juveniles: Juvenile bluebirds from both species are also similar in appearance, with gray-blue plumage and some orange or reddish coloration on the breast.
birdertopia.com/eastern-bluebird-vs-western-bluebird/Female Bluebirds ©Rob Ripma Female mountain bluebird. The females of eastern and western bluebirds appear quite similar. However, the female mountain bluebird is much more likely than the male to be confused with the other two species. Note how the female mountain bluebird is brown rather than orange like the eastern and western bluebirds.
